Nothing is more heartwarming than the sight of the youngest members of our community running to the sanctuary for Shabbat! Typically held on the first Saturday of the month, Tot Shabbat affords our children and their families the time and space to truly experience the joys of Shabbat. The Silver Line, NVHC's 55+ group (no one is asking) hosts a monthly Shabbat dinner we like to call Kugel Cafe. We meet at 5:30pm to schmooze and enjoy a delicious catered meal together before heading down to the Sanctuary for Erev Shabbat services at 7:00pm. Questions?
